What is Recruitment Process Outsourcing (RPO), and how does it work?
RPO is a process where businesses outsource part or all of their recruitment functions to an external provider specializing in talent acquisition. Unlike traditional hiring methods, RPO involves end-to-end recruitment management, from sourcing candidates to onboarding. This is a question I come across quite often. BPO deals with the outsourcing of non-core processes, such as payroll or customer support, whereas RPO targets recruitment. For example, while a BPO provider might handle the call center operations of a financial firm, Recruit Ninjas steps in to handle recruitment for specialized roles, which must be done according to industry standards.What is the e-recruitment process, and why is it important for modern hiring?
E-recruitment is the application of digital technology to automate and optimize hiring. From AI resume screenings to video interviews, the process is one that is fundamental to scaling recruitment efforts in an extremely competitive market.
